Male extras needed for short film being shot in Sidmouth

By The Editor

28th Aug 2019 | Local News

Male extras are needed for a short film being shot in Sidmouth by Devon based production company Spinning Path.

The short film, called Shuttlecock, is a drama about the changing face of masculinity and how a traditional man might struggle to cope with his status in society - all centred around an amateur badminton club.

Director Tommy Gillard has been commissioned by Exeter Phoenix to create the film that will premiere at the Two Short Nights film festival at Exeter Phoenix later this year.

Having received the audience choice award at last years film festival Tommy said: "I'm really excited to be making this film with the support from Exeter Phoenix. We wanted to make a film focused on badminton as it's an under represented sport in film."

The film will be shot in Sidmouth College's sports hall which has plans to be demolished next year.
